Zulassen, dass Code hinter Dokumenten mit eingeschränkten Berechtigungen ausgeführt wird

Sie können das IrM-Feature (Information Rights Management, Verwaltung von Informationsrechten) von Microsoft Office verwenden, um Berechtigungen für ein Dokument oder eine Arbeitsmappe einzuschränken. Standardmäßig ist der Code hinter einem eingeschränkten Microsoft Office Word-Dokument oder einer Microsoft Office Excel-Arbeitsmappe nicht zulässig. Sie können die Standardeinstellung ändern, sodass Ihre Erweiterungen mit verwaltetem Code auf das Objektmodell zugreifen können, und Ihre Lösung funktioniert.

Gilt für: Die Informationen in diesem Thema gelten für Projekte auf Dokumentebene für Excel und Word. Weitere Informationen finden Sie unter features available by Office-App lication and project type.

Sie müssen der Autor des Dokuments oder der Arbeitsmappe sein oder vollzugriff haben, um die Berechtigungseinstellungen ändern zu können.

So lassen Sie Code für die Ausführung von Dokumenten mit eingeschränkten Berechtigungen zu

  1. Öffnen Sie das Dokument oder die Arbeitsmappe in Word oder Excel.

  2. Klicken Sie auf die Registerkarte "Datei ", zeigen Sie auf "Vorbereiten", zeigen Sie auf " Berechtigung einschränken", und klicken Sie dann auf " Eingeschränkter Zugriff".

    Hinweis

    Bei der ersten Verwendung werden Sie aufgefordert, den Windows Rights Management-Client zu installieren. Nachdem Sie den Client installiert haben, müssen Sie die Schritte möglicherweise wiederholen.

  3. Wählen Sie im Dialogfeld "Berechtigung" die Option "Berechtigung für dieses Dokument einschränken" aus, und klicken Sie dann auf "Weitere Optionen".

  4. Wählen Sie unter "Zusätzliche Berechtigungen für Benutzer" programmgesteuert Access-Inhalte aus.

    Word oder Excel ermöglicht den programmgesteuerten Zugriff auf das Objektmodell.